SET A TRAP

 
Piece Title : Set a Trap

Programme Notes / Performance Details :



















B


This 8-10 minute long solo was composed for a small set up of instruments similar to drum set/ traps set of instruments. The opening is energetic with a quick comotion, usingB B many meter changes, creatingB a semi improvisatory character. The basic theme is a combinationB of 5/8 &B B 6/8 measures.B This leads to a quiet section in which one hand continuously rolls (first on a cymbal and later on the Triangle)while the other oneB plays a subdued 6/8B Siciliana like rhythm with a wire brush. This section, having served as a breather of sorts,B gradually fades out bringing forth a comlpex cannon played with both hands, one against the other (each using a different mallet/stick so as to create different "voices").


B


The texture becomes thicker and the section ends with a quick accelerando which, in a burst, brings forth the final part of the piece , a bright virtuosic coda , mostly in a quick 7/8 with 2/4 inserts. The fast, breathless pace isB gradually slowed down via use of a series of counter rhythms until a complete, loud, grandioseB halt of the commotion.
